ECE Ambassadors Stop by Penfield’s Health & Safety Day

Our dedicated Early Childhood Education Ambassadors made their latest stop at Penfield Children's Center for their annual Health & Safety Day on July 11. The event was well-attended by ECE providers, employees and families, making it an excellent opportunity to connect with those most impacted by the ongoing struggles facing the sector.

"Many ECE employees caught wind of our organization as we continued talking about the vital need for continued ECE supports at every level," said Anna Smerchek, community engagement fellow. "Soon enough, our table was filled with folks eager to join in the fight for ECE!"

The ambassadors shared the important work Milwaukee Succeeds and the MKE ECE Coalition are doing to support access to affordable, high-quality care in Milwaukee, as well as identifying leaders in the ECE space to serve as champions for the cause.

The event also featured literacy supports, health and wellness checks, fire safety, the Milwaukee Police Department, Head Start and Children's Hospital. Attendees enjoyed engagement activities, including a fantastic performance by the Milwaukee Bucks' Rim Rockers and Bango the Buck. Penfield's ECE classrooms joined in the fun, as well, with both the educators and kids enjoying the festivities.

Throughout the rest of the summer, our ECE Ambassadors will continue targeting partner spaces to increase awareness about ECE and Milwaukee Succeeds and identify leaders willing to help share the word.
